Well, we don't know exactly what the government said, and that was before the superseding indictment.  We also don't know what the government said in their Florida Garcia request, either.

1 hour ago, wildcat09 said:

It was public knowledge that the DC grand jury remained ongoing and why should be obvious to everyone: because those clowns committed like 1,000,000 crimes in DC, and had only been indicted in Florida for a few that also connected to Mar-a-Lago.

We know that the investigation started with a grand jury in DC for legitimate reasons.  We also know that a grand jury was impaneled in Fla for purposes of the two indictments here, because a grand jury should sit where the case is venued.  If you're not at least a little bit curious as to the division of responsibility between the two grand juries, I can't really help ya.

So we have the following facts:

  • the government notified the Florida court of a Garcia hearing happening pertaining to Yuscil Taveras in DC on or about June 28: "The Government notified this Court on the same day, by sealed notice, of the filing in the District of Columbia:
  • a superseding indictment issues from the Florida grand jury a month later on July 27 making Yuscil Taveras a key witness and raising a conflict issue as to Waltine Nauta
  • on August 2, the government files for a Garcia hearing for Nauta on what apparently is a conflict not resolved by the earlier hearing and in the process reveals an investigation that is in addition to, but also directly involves the Florida case

It's not unreasonable to ask some questions under those circumstances.
